Stoney Stanton Quarryman Sculpture

Highlight • Structure

After the tree was felled at Stoney Stanton, the parish council decided to do something with the remaining trunk.

After consulting with residents in the area, it was decided that a sculpture of a quarryman would be made out of the trunk.

Thornton Reservoir

Highlight • Natural

Thornton Reservoir nestles in a picturesque National Forest valley and is home to much wildlife, including mammals, birds, butterflies and dragonflies. There is a traffic free trail all around the reservoir, which makes for a lovely walk.

Thornton Reservoir

Highlight • Lake

Reservoir Road runs alongside Thornton Reservoir offering wide open views of the water and surrounding countryside.

The reservoir, built in the 19th century, is a vital water supply for the region and is home to a variety of wildlife, making it a popular spot for birdwatching.

Stoney Cove is a large flooded quarry that hosts the UK National Dive Centre. There is a heated pool for dive training, and the bed of the cove is described as an underwater adventure park!

Above the surface, there is a pub/cafe and it's also a great spot to catch a glimpse of peregrine falcons/
